Crystallophysical, electrophysical and photoelectrical properties of Zn//xCd//1// minus //xS solid solution films in the whole range of compositions 0 less than equivalent to x less than equivalent to 1 fabricated on large area substrates (about 100 cm**2) by chemical vapor deposition (CVD) in hydrogen flow for use in solar cells are discussed in this paper.
